Summary

I have done every type of job out there. I started as an indentured servant at a young age. As a free black man, I decided to join the militia, and served garrison duty until medically discharges due to typhus. After that, I wrote out against slavery and abolition. In 1780 I got my license to preach and then ordained in 1785. I served at West Parish church until I was let go without reason in 1818.

Work History

Militia Man

Continental Army
  • Started in 1774
  • 1775; Went to Roxbury Massachusets following the Battle of Lexington and Concord
  • Remained in active duty until contracted typhus

Writter

Self Employed
  • In 1776, offered a rebuttal to the Declaration of Independence, called "Liberty Further Extended". Never published but discovered in 1983.
  • Wrote out against slavery
  • Liberty is a devine gift for ALL men

Minister

God
  • 1780 granted license to preach
  • Missionary in the wilderness of the New Hampshire Grants
  • Ordained in 1785 becoming the first African-American
  • Preached at West Parish Church for 30 years
  • 1818 I was dismissed and was not told why
